The Michigan Model for Health (MMH), a universal, skills-based curriculum implemented in Michigan & 39 other states, was updated to address opioid misuse. This study evaluates the initial rollout of the updated curriculum:

A quick reminder: For every $1 of research funding, NIH generated $2.46 in economic activity. This includes funding jobs in all 50 states. This isn't a red/blue thing: 8.9 jobs per $1M in CA & 12 jobs per $1M in GA. #AcademicSky #PhDSky #MedSky #HealthSky #healthequity #SciComm

The Trump administration has halted disbursement of funds from a program that supplies most of the treatment for HIV in Africa and low-income countries worldwide for at least 90 days.

www.nytimes.com/2025/01/24/u...
Trump Pauses Disbursements to Program Supplying H.I.V. Treatment Worldwide (Gift Article)
Pepfar, which is estimated to have delivered lifesaving treatment to as many as 25 million people in 54 countries, faces a funding delay of as long as 180 days.
